Medical Malpractice

The medical professionals who take care of your child can have significant influence on the future of your family. If they make a mistake that results in birth defects or injuries your child could be facing years of financial hardship as well as emotional and physical struggles throughout their lives.

Birth injury attorneys can assist you bring a claim against the people who are accountable for the medical issues of your child or injuries, whether it's an institution or doctor who made a mistake during birthing process or if the cause of the birth defect of your child was something that occurred to your baby before birth. A Queens birth defects lawyer can analyze your situation and provide valuable information, and connect you with medical experts to examine the evidence.

A doctor may make a mistake that can lead to a birth defect such as the prescription of medication that increased your baby's risk of being affected or if he failed to carry out certain screenings and tests during pregnancy. These are examples of medical negligence that could be grounds for an action. If you believe that a medical error caused a birth defect in your child, you may be entitled to compensation for past as well as future health costs. A successful lawsuit may also compensate you for your loss of income, emotional distress or other losses which you've suffered.

Defective Drugs

Many birth defects are caused by prescription drugs or over-the-counter medicines and chemical exposure at the workplace or at home as well as other environmental hazards. Unfortunately, these medical conditions are costly. Parents often wonder why the condition of their child came about and what to do when charges pile up for expensive treatments and procedures.

Drug makers must ensure that their products are tested thoroughly before they are released for sale and must anticipate any potential adverse reactions. If they fail to do so and fail to do so, they could be held responsible for any lawsuits filed by affected consumers. An knowledgeable birth defect attorney can help determine if an unsuitable medication could be responsible for your child's health complications.

If you think that your child's birth defect is caused by a specific medication begin by logging your symptoms and keeping the medication packaging and receipts. It is also important to record the date you first noticed symptoms in your child. This information is crucial in determining the statute of limitations.

If your child was exposed to a toxic substance that contributed to the condition, you have only one year to bring a lawsuit. Product Liability

Birth defects and birth injuries continue to occur despite the fact that medical technology has significantly reduced the risk of pregnancy. These problems can have a major impact on the lives of parents and children.

While many birth problems and injuries are caused by genetic or environmental factors but they can also be due to health care providers' negligence during pregnancy or delivery. These errors include prescribing incorrect medications or failing to check the mother for signs prenatal damage.

The distinction between a birth injury and a birth defect may be confusing. Although birth injuries can occur during labor and birth and birth defects are a result of the womb, and often have a long-term effect on the fetus' general body structure or function.
